US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"this is accomplished through"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to explain the method or process by which something is achieved or completed. Example: "The project is successful because this is accomplished through effective teamwork and communication."

Expert writing Tips

Best practice

Use "this is accomplished through" to clearly articulate the specific methods or processes that lead to a particular outcome. Ensure the subsequent explanation is precise and directly relevant to the accomplishment being described.

Common error

Avoid using "this is accomplished through" without providing specific details about the method. Vague statements can leave the reader unclear about how the result was achieved.

FAQs

How can I use "this is accomplished through" in a sentence?

Use "this is accomplished through" to explain the specific method or process used to achieve a particular result. For example, "The project's success "this is accomplished through" effective teamwork and communication".

What are some alternatives to "this is accomplished through"?

You can use alternatives such as "this is achieved by", "this is realized via", or "this is attained by means of" depending on the context.

Is "this is accomplished through" formal or informal?

"This is accomplished through" is suitable for both formal and neutral contexts. However, depending on the audience and purpose, you might choose a more formal or informal alternative.

What's the difference between "this is accomplished through" and "this is done through"?

While similar, "this is done through" is slightly more informal. "This is accomplished through" often implies a more deliberate or strategic approach.
